Answer: [tex]\frac{18}{25}[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
First, lets find the volume of both of them individually,
The formula for this is V=πr²h (V = volume, r = radius, h = height)
Lets do cylinder A first! Simply plug in your numbers
V = 3.14 · 3² · 4
V = 3.14 · 9 · 4
V = 113.04 this is the volume of cylinder A
Repeat these steps for cylinder B
V = 3.14 · 5² · 2
V = 3.14 · 25 · 2
V = 157
Without simplifying, the ratio is [tex]\frac{133.04}{157}[/tex]
With simplifying, your answer is A, [tex]\frac{18}{25}[/tex]
